PUTRAJAYA, Dec 7 (Bernama) -- Prime Minister Datuk Seri Anwar Ibrahim today launched two initiatives under the people's development agenda, namely the Sahabat Penggerak MADANI programme and the People's Welfare Insurance Scheme (SIKR) 3.0.
Both initiatives are part of the government's efforts to strengthen the social safety net and empower communities at the grassroots level.
The launch was held in conjunction with the Rancakkan MADANI Bersama Malaysiaku Programme and the National Convention on Public Service Reform 2025 for three days from Friday and concluding today.
The two initiatives mark the government's continued commitment to empowering the people's well-being based on MADANI values and an inclusive social protection system.

The launch ceremony was the culmination of the Rancakkan MADANI programme with various contents including interactive exhibitions, sharing sessions and a forum for reforming the public delivery system.
Sahabat Penggerak MADANI are individuals trained by the Malaysian Academy of Nationhood (AKM) to become agents of awareness and understanding of nationhood, leadership and current government policies at the grassroots level.
SIKR is an initiative of the MADANI Government to ensure that the poor and hardcore poor based on eKasih receive insurance coverage.
After launching both initiatives, Anwar also held a walkabout session to mingle with participants and visitors in the exhibition area before leaving the main hall.
The Rancakkan MADANI programme is a continuation of the One-Year Programme with the MADANI Government and the Two-Year Programme with the MADANI Government which has become a tradition of the government's annual reporting directly to the people.
Concurrent with the programme, the National Convention on Public Service Reform 2025 was also held which brought together policy thinkers among civil servants and industry players.
The national-scale programme organised by the Prime Minister's Office through the Performance Acceleration Coordination Unit (PACU) has successfully attracted 304,107 visitors in the two days of the programme, exceeding the target of 300,000 visitors.
